Farmers’ Knowledge Centre inaugurated at Mohanpur
Agartala, Jan 16, 2023, TRIPURA TIMES Desk
Agartala, Jan 16: Education minister Ratanlal Nath on Monday said the state government has taken various steps to increase the farmers’ income.
After inaugurating a Farmers’ Knowledge Centre at Mohanpur block complex, he said, highest priority is being given to the development of the Agriculture sector along with healthcare and education sectors.
He said, the goal of building Atmanirbhar Tripura can’t be achieved without making the farmers Atmanirbhar. With this view, the state government has taken steps including procurement of paddy at minimum support price and the farmers are receiving the benefit.
Chairman of Mohanpur Panchayat Samity Reena Debbarma, chairperson of Mohanpur municipal council Anita Debnath and corporator Matilal Das were also present in the inaugural programme.
Superintendent of Agriculture, Mohanpur- Uttam Saha delivered the welcome address. The Farmers’ Knowledge Centre has been built at an expenditure of Rs. 58 lakh.
Meanwhile, the Education minister also inaugurated a sub-health centre at Tulabagan Chowmuhani.
